持续集成

无论你使用哪种平台和语言,Visual Studio Team Services 都可以简化应用程序的持续集成。
立即免费使用
Representation of the cycle of continuous integration. Includes logos for Java, NUnit, Maven, Git, and more.
Screenshot of

集成

关联测试结果、工作项、代码和发布

想知道某个缺陷是否已得到修复? 将工作项关联到代码,这些工作项即可在生成摘要中与代码更改和测试结果一同列出。

托管生成代理

无需安装

Visual Studio Team Services 提供了可以快速生成项目的托管生成代理;同时,灵活的生成系统也允许用户安装自己的代理。 每个帐户获得 1 个免费代理,包括每月 4 小时的生成。
Screenshot of Hosted build agents
Multi-platform Devices include Windows laptops, iOS Tablets, and Android phones. Symbols include .NET, Java, Xcode, and Git

多平台

在 Windows、Mac 和 Linux 上进行本机构建

使用我们的 Windows 或多平台代理生成 Xcode、Android、iOS、Java、.NET 和其他类型的应用程序。

企业级支持

安全性、池和队列管理

定义不同的组并分配生成内容的查看、编辑、创建和队列操作权限,以此管理生成访问。 跨项目管理和共享生成资源。 控制对生成资源(池和队列)的访问。 审核对生成内容的更改。
Enterprise readiness
Continuous integration lifecycle represented with symbols

持续集成

适合任何应用程序的自动化生成

创建和管理可以在云端或本地自动编译和测试应用程序的生成流程;这些操作可以按需执行,也可以包含在自动持续集成策略中。 我们有大量开放源代码的可扩展生成任务,它们可以重复使用而且支持 Ant、Maven、Gradle 等。你可以借助它们生成自己的 TFVC、Git 和 GitHub 项目,并运行 JUnit、NUnit、xUnit、MSTest、Jasmine 和其他类型的测试框架。
详细了解 JavaVisual Studio

诊断

查看历史更改和输出日志

审核生成定义的更改,通过比较了解变化趋势。 在生成运行期间实时查看代理输出日志,通过下载进行更深入的分析。
Icons representing Diagnostic Reports and Tools
Screenshot of Continuous deployment Definition Templates for Azure Cloud Services and Azure Website

连续部署

生成、测试和部署

使用部署模板将自己的项目部署到本地环境、混合环境或云(Azure、AWS、Google 等)环境。
详细了解 DevOpsRelease Management

使用云服务

免费试用

自己托管它

下载试用版